JavaScript
IBLiplus
这个作者很懒,什么都没留下…
展开
-
JavaScript定义函数的3种方式
JavaScript函数是一种基于对象的脚本语言,JavaScript代码复用的单位是函数。JavaScript中的函数可以独立存在,而且JavaScript中的函数完全可以作为一个类来使用(而且它还是该类的唯一的构造器)。函数也可以是一个对象,函数本身就是Function实例。以下是定义函数的3中方式:定义命名函数 <script type="text/javasc...原创 2018-07-16 20:05:30 · 1474 阅读 · 0 评论 -
jquery实现多选框全选全不选
其实是一个很简单的功能,有的时候在网上找的文档,里面写的根本就不管用,索性自己备份一下吧!代码如下,绝对好使:function bit(){ if($("#purchasingckAll").is(':checked')){ $('input[data="id"]').each(function(){ $(this).prop("checked",true); });...原创 2018-10-31 20:45:47 · 640 阅读 · 1 评论 -
a连接传递参数实现文件下载
Java后端代码如下: @RequestMapping(value="/atoDownLoad") private ModelAndView atoDownLoad(HttpServletResponse response,HttpServletRequest request) throws Exception { ModelAndView mv = this.getModelA...原创 2018-10-29 22:23:12 · 2054 阅读 · 0 评论 -
ace input file 上传
HTML代码<div class="form-group"> <form id="addForm" action="" enctype="multipart/form-data"> <label class="col-sm-2 control-label text-right"><b cl原创 2018-10-11 16:47:18 · 5456 阅读 · 2 评论 -
改变action解决一个form表单多个submit的情况
有的时候在前端页面使用form表单提交时,需要提交的内容是一样的,但是执行的操作可能不同,提交到controller中的不同方法中,可能执行增删,或者改查,执行的操作不同,所以form表单提交的action也是不同的,下面通过代码展示一下这个问题如何解决,其实很简单:html代码:<form id="Assistant_form${item.getId()}" name="nam...原创 2018-08-29 22:01:34 · 1296 阅读 · 0 评论 -
jquery判断元素是否隐藏
for(var i = 0;i < updatebook.length;i++){ updatebook[i].onclick=function(){ if($("#update_div"+this.id).css("visibility")!="hidden"){ $("#update_div"+this.id).css("visibility","h原创 2018-08-17 09:03:39 · 942 阅读 · 0 评论 -
JavaScript中string类型转换为json类型
在使用一个插件时,它的数据接收的是json数组的类型,但是我写的是servlet中的数据是list格式的,这里我们可以将list中的数据整理一下,整理成“json”类型的字符串,这些数据传到jsp中是string类型的,需要我们转一下格式:<div> <% String strs= (String)request.getAttribute("outstr");%&g...原创 2018-08-19 18:14:46 · 1978 阅读 · 0 评论 -
js代码实现简易分页插件
下面是我使用js代码实现的一个简易分页功能的插件:链接:https://pan.baidu.com/s/1Gu23ODCLr3HYu3hJBTNCow 密码:l8we然后我们看一下它的实现方式:<div id="gl_update" > <% String strs= (String)request.getAttribute("outstr");%> ...原创 2018-08-19 18:00:56 · 409 阅读 · 0 评论 -
导航栏实现页面的动态切换
我们经常会在一些网站上通过点击一些导航栏中的分类来显式不同的内容来浏览,下面的方式可以实现这种效果。function change(){ var left1 = $(".index1left"); // alert(left1.length); // id 1 2 3 4 for(var i = 0;i < left1.length;i++){ lef...原创 2018-08-02 22:29:13 · 8120 阅读 · 0 评论 -
判断一个div是否在可视范围内
当网页页面上需要添加锚点回到顶部时,要判断当前页面的浏览情况,比如规定一个点,当它出现在可视范围内时,显式回到顶部的图标,否则,回到顶部的图标隐藏。代码如下:<!DOCTYPE html><html><head lang="en"> <meta charset="UTF-8"> <title>&原创 2018-08-06 22:48:04 · 2087 阅读 · 0 评论 -
搜索框的回车事件(搜索内容在另一个页面展示)
功能要求是这样的:搜索框输入要查询的内容,敲击回车,页面跳转到新的页面,并且搜索的内容也会在新的页面展示;当搜索框获得焦点时,默认的搜索框中的值隐藏,如果没有输入任何内容,搜索框失去焦点后,显式原来的默认value值;代码如下:<input type="text" name="search_index" id="search_index" onkeydown="entersearc...原创 2018-08-03 19:52:37 · 4193 阅读 · 1 评论 -
JavaScript中的复合类型
复合类型是由许多基本数据类型(也可以包括基本数据类型)组成的数据题,JavaScript中的复合类型大致上分为如下3种:Object类:对象 Array:数组 Function:函数对象对象是一系列命名变量,函数的集合,其中变量的类型可以是基本类型也可以是复合类型,对象中的命名变量称为属性,而对象中的函数称为方法。对象访问属性和函数的方法是通过” . ”来实现的。JavaScript是基于对...原创 2018-07-15 15:18:32 · 3899 阅读 · 0 评论 -
JavaScript中的基本数据类型
JavaScript是弱类型脚本语言,声明变量是无须指定变量的数据类型。JavaScript变量的数据类型是解释时动态决定的,但是JavaScript的值保存在内存中时,也是有数据类型的。JavaScript的基本数据类型有以下:数值类型: 包含整型和浮点型布尔类型:只有true和false两个值字符串类型:字符串必须使用单引号或者双引号括起来Undefined类型:表示已经创建但是...原创 2018-07-15 00:02:24 · 689 阅读 · 0 评论 -
JavaScript数据类型与变量
1.1 变量定义的方法js是一种弱类型脚本语言,在使用变量之前,可以无需定义,想使用某个变量时直接使用。JavaScript支持两种方式老引入变量:、A) 隐式定义:直接给变量赋值B) 显示定义:使用var关键字定义变量没有固定的数据类型,因此可以对同一个变量在不同的时间赋不同的值。JavaScript中的变量是区分大小写的!1.2类型转换:JavaScript支持自动类型转换,这种类型转换的功能...原创 2018-07-10 23:14:06 · 238 阅读 · 0 评论 -
JavaScript中创建对象的3中方式
JavaScript对象是一个特殊的数据结构,JavaScript对象只是一种特殊的关联数组,创建对象并不是总需要先创建类,与纯粹的面向对象语言不同的是,JavaScript中创建对象可以不使用任何类,JavaScript中创建对象的3种方式如下:使用new关键字调用构造器创建对象 使用Object类创建对象 使用JSON语法创建对象下面我们先通过代码展示第一种创建对象的方法:Jav...原创 2018-07-17 21:49:30 · 327 阅读 · 0 评论 -
JavaScript实现伪继承的方式
下面通过代码展示在JavaScript中如何实现伪继承, <script type="text/javascript"> function Person(name ,age){ this.name = name; this.age = age; this.sayHello = function(){ c...原创 2018-07-17 12:37:42 · 387 阅读 · 0 评论 -
JavaScript中的局部函数
其实在之前的博客中已经设计到JavaScript中的全局变量和局部变量的内容,今天我们主要借助局部变量来引出局部函数的内容。首先回顾一下之前的内容:在函数里使用var定义的变量称为局部变量,在函数外定义的变量和在函数内不适用var定义的变量则称为全局变量,如果局部变量和全局变量的变量名相同,则局部变量会覆盖全局变量。局部变量只能在函数能访问,而全局变量可以在所有的函数里访问。和变量相类似,...原创 2018-07-16 21:34:03 · 1912 阅读 · 0 评论 -
jquery动态控制div显示隐藏
对于经常使用到的代码,在博客上备份一下,用到时,如果想不起来,直接copy过去。最近在做项目的时候,经常卡在前段这方面,所以,对于经常用到的代码,如果一直出错的话,我们直接copy,不浪费时间;$(function(){ $('#select_condition_div').click(function(){//点击a标签 if($('#select_out_big_div...原创 2018-11-01 19:31:53 · 9676 阅读 · 0 评论